Ice melts: Imran Khan confirms talks with army chief


Imran Khan army chief

ISLAMABAD: Former prime minister and PTI founder Imran Khan confirmed talks between party chairman Gohar Ali Khan and army chief Asim Munir dubbing it a “positive development.”

PTI chairman Gohar Ali Khan had denied a meeting with the army chief a day earlier.

In an informal chat with reporters in the courtroom of Adiala Jail, Imran Khan was asked if a meeting between PTI chairman and army chief was held. Imran Khan at first reluctantly replied he had no details in this regard.

However, later he confirmed the meeting and said that this is a positive development and is good for the stability of Pakistan.

“We had never closed the doors of negotiations. The establishment should talk to us. I am an advocate of talks. But the other side was reluctant”, Imran Khan said.

Now if talks have begun, they will be for Pakistan’s stability, he said.

BARRISTER GOHAR CONFIRMS MEETING WITH ARMY CHIEF

Chairman PTI Barrister Gohar confirmed that he along with Ali Amin Gandapur, held a private meeting with the army chief.

He stated that all PTI matters and demands were presented to the Army Chief, along with their concerns.

He added that discussions during the meeting focused on national stability, and they received a positive response from the other side.

Direct negotiations with the establishment are a welcome development, and there is hope that the situation will now improve.
